As I often say, lots of sewing but only one small finish. I made these twelve donation blocks for Kat’s March/April block drive. They used two yards of fabric.

But I didn’t buy any fabric, so that helps.

This week: + 0 yards, – 2 yards

This year: + 33.75 yards, – 46.50 yards

Net destashed added in 2018: 12.75 yards

I am continuing to work on this leaders and enders quilt.

I didn’t have enough fabric to miter the borders (so that the colors matched, so I made these cornerstones.
